## Local Setup — Dark Mode

The Quillbarrow admin dashboard resolves theme tokens at runtime. Plugins must not hardcode colors; import variables from the theme bundle instead. Dark mode is toggled via the user preferences table, so your local instance needs a seeded database.

Steps:

1. Clone the plugin starter kit.
2. Run the token sync script.
3. Seed preferences with the fixture loader.
4. Start the dev server and toggle themes from the avatar menu.

Point the fixture loader at the sandbox database using the connection string below.

replica DSN, kajep-yahag: mssql://praok_svc:iF@db-8d68.plorvaio.local:5432/eliion

Default compatibility mode for new event subjects has changed from NONE to BACKWARD. Support should expect tickets from teams whose producers previously registered breaking schema revisions without errors; those registrations will now be rejected at publish time. The retention window for soft-deleted subjects was also raised from 7 to 30 days, so restores are possible for longer. No action is needed for existing subjects, which keep their prior mode. The new defaults shipping with v4.2.0 are listed below.

deployment values, kajep-kageg:
[praix]
host = praix.paliqcorp.corp
user = praix_svc
database = praix_prod

## Onboarding: Squatwatch Scanner

Squatwatch crawls the Fernbright package registry nightly and flags names within edit distance two of popular packages. Your first task is triaging its findings queue. If the scanner's state database corrupts, restore it with the recovery tool, which asks for the team passphrase before unlocking backups. The current passphrase is:

vault phrase of fawif-haduf = wenwyn-briath

// MAX_FORMULA_EVAL_MS bounds execution of user-supplied formulas inside
// the Quillix sandbox. Each formula runs in an isolated interpreter with
// no filesystem or network access; this timeout is the last line of
// defense against runaway loops. If paged for sandbox timeouts, check
// the interpreter build identified by the token below.

pipeline stamp: htk31_f769b577b3028a4e9958e5bb8d1259a